What is a Ration Card?

A ration card is an official document issued by the government that allows individuals or families to buy food grains, kerosene and other essential items at subsidized rates from government-approved shops. Ration cards serve as an important tool to tackle food shortages and ensure that every citizen has access to affordable food. These aim to provide a social safety net and prevent hoarding and price manipulation of essential commodities.

Ration cards are usually issued to low-income families, but there are different categories based on economic criteria. These Ration cards help in identifying eligible beneficiaries for various government welfare schemes Which Are Launched By the Indian government. There are Different Types of Ration Cards In India.

How Many Colours Ration Cards In India?

In 1999, the tricolour ration cards were implemented to eliminate discrimination in the food supply. The common colour ration cards that are widely used in India are listed below.

  • Yellow Ration Cards
  • Saffron Ration Cards
  • White Ration Cards

Yellow:

The Main Features of Yellow Ration Card Are the Following And Eligibility To Get Yellow Ration Cards is given below.

  • Families having annual income up to Rs.15,000/-(Urban Area)
  • None of the members of the family should be a doctor, lawyer, architect or chartered accountant.
  • None of the members in the family should be professional taxpayers, sales taxpayers or income taxpayers or eligible to pay such tax.
  • The family should not possess a residential telephone.
  • The family should not possess a Two-wheeler vehicle.
  • All the persons in the family should not hold a total of two hectares of rain-fed or one hectare of semi-irrigated or 1/2 hectare of irrigated(double in drought-affected talukas) land.

Saffron:

The Main Features of Saffron Ration Card Are the Following And Eligibility To Get Yellow Ration Cards is given below.

  • Families having an annual income of Rs.15,001 to 1 lakh Can Apply For this Ration Card.
  • None of the members in the family should have four-wheeler mechanical vehicles(excluding taxis).
  • The family in all should possess four hectares or more irrigated land.

White:

The Main Features of White Ration Card Are the Following And Eligibility To Get Yellow Ration Cards is given below.

  • The Families having annual income of Rs.1 Lakh or above, any member of the family possessing a four-wheeler or the family aggregately holding more than 4 hectares of irrigated land issued white ration cards.

Ration Card 2024 New List: Benefits of Different Types of Ration Cards

Ration Card Type Benefits
Antyodaya Anna Yojana (AAY) ration card
  • Beneficiary Gets 35 kg of food grains per month per family at subsidized rates.
Priority Household (PHH) ration card
  • Beneficiary Gets 5 kg of food grains per person monthly at subsidized rates.
Non-Priority Household (NPHH) ration card
  • Beneficiary Gets No food grains are provided under this card. It only acts as an identity proof.
Below Poverty Line (BPL) ration card
  • Beneficiary Gets 10 kg to 20 kg of food grains per family per month at 50% of the economic cost.
Above Poverty Line (APL) ration card
  • Beneficiary Gets 10 kg to 20 kg of food grains per family per month at 100% of the economic cost.
Annapoorna Yojana (AY) ration card
  • The beneficiary gets 10 kg of food grains per month at subsidized rates.

Ration Card List: Who cannot Apply For a Ration Card?

According to the rules of the Central Government, only eligible people should get the benefit of the facility given by the ration card. That is, ration cards should be made for those who are poor and needy and ration cards should not be made for those who are capable. We will know below whose ration card cannot be made.

  • The applicant or any member of their family should not be a government employee.
  • Individuals or citizens who own a flat, house, plot or bungalow of 100 square meters or more. He cannot get a ration card made.
  • Persons who have a four-wheeler, car, tractor etc. are not eligible for ration cards.
  • Persons whose annual income is more than 3 lakhs, whether they are from the village or the city, are not eligible for the ration card.
  • For people of rural areas whose annual income is more than 2 lakhs, their ration card cannot be made.
  • People in urban areas whose annual income is more than 3 lakhs cannot get the benefit of ration cards.
  • Ration cards cannot be made for people who have 5 acres of land and income taxpayers.
  • If the applicant is less than 18 years of age, he cannot get a ration card. The name of the child below 18 years of age will be added to their parents’ ration card.
  • The name of any family member should not be on any other ration card.
  • The applicant should not have a ration card from any other state.

Ration Card Status 2024: Check Ration Card Application Status Online

After the application of the ration card, the applicants want to know the status of their ration card application. The status of the ration card application can be checked through the National Food Security Portal and the Food Security Portal of the states. If You are a resident of any state, you can check the status of your ration card through the National Food Security Portal – https://nfsa.gov.in/, For this, you need to follow the following steps. Follow these steps to check the status of your ration card application Online From the Official Website.

  • First You Need to Visit the official website of the National Food Security Portal (NFSA) at https://nfsa.gov.in/.
  • Now Home Page Will Appear before you.
  • Now Click on the “Know Your Ration Card Status” option on the site or directly go here: https://nfsa.gov.in/public/frmPublicGetMyRCDetails.aspx.
  • Now Under “Search Expression” enter your ration card number.
  • Next, Complete the Captcha verification and click on “Get RC Details”
  • Now your Ration Card Will Appear before you.
  • View the information displayed on the screen And Click on the Download Button.

How to Link Aadhaar with Ration Card Online in 2024?

Here is the Complete Process to Link Aadhar Card With Ration Card Online. The full Process is Given below.

  • First Go to your state’s Official Public Distribution System (PDS) portal
  • Now One Home page Select the Aadhaar Link Option.
  • Now Enter Details Like your Ration card number followed by your Aadhaar card number.
  • Also, Add your registered mobile phone number.
  • Now Click On Submit and Verify:
  • On the Next Step Click Continue/Submit.
  • Now An OTP will be dispatched to your mobile. You Need to Enter it on the Aadhaar Ration Link page.
  • You Will Receive an SMS notification upon the successful completion of the process.
